Ingredients

Scale
  • 1.5 lbs boneless chicken thighs
  • 1 medium onion, finely chopped
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tbsp fresh ginger, grated
  • 2 tbsp curry powder
  • 1 can (14 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 1 can (13.5 oz) full-fat coconut milk
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are your ingredients by chopping the onion, garlic, and ginger.
  2. In a large pan over medium heat, sauté the onion until translucent. Add garlic and ginger; cook until fragrant.
  3. Brown the chicken thighs on all sides for about 5 minutes.
  4. Stir in curry powder along with salt and pepper; cook for another 2 minutes.
  5. Add diced tomatoes and coconut milk; stir well and bring to a gentle simmer.
  6. Let the curry bubble gently for about 20 minutes until thickened.
  7. Garnish with fresh cilantro before serving over rice or with naan.
